Key Components of Environmental Sustainability Innovation Programs
Environmental sustainability innovation programs are built on a foundation of principles that prioritize ecological balance, resource efficiency, and long-term viability. At their core, these programs aim to integrate environmental considerations into every aspect of decision-making and operations. Key components include:
- Circular Economy Practices: Transitioning from a linear "take-make-dispose" model to a circular system where resources are reused, recycled, and regenerated.
- Carbon Neutrality Goals: Implementing strategies to reduce greenhouse gas emissions and offset remaining emissions through renewable energy or carbon credits.
- Resource Optimization: Minimizing waste and maximizing the efficient use of water, energy, and raw materials.
- Stakeholder Engagement: Collaborating with employees, customers, suppliers, and communities to drive collective action.
- Innovation and Technology: Leveraging cutting-edge technologies like AI, IoT, and blockchain to monitor, manage, and optimize sustainability efforts.

Case Studies in Environmental Sustainability Innovation Programs
- Patagonia's Circular Economy Model: The outdoor apparel company has implemented a "Worn Wear" program, encouraging customers to repair, reuse, and recycle their products. This initiative not only reduces waste but also strengthens customer loyalty.
- Unilever's Sustainable Living Plan: Unilever has integrated sustainability into its core business strategy, focusing on reducing environmental impact while doubling its growth. The company has achieved significant reductions in water use, waste, and greenhouse gas emissions.
- Tesla's Renewable Energy Ecosystem: Tesla's innovation in electric vehicles and solar energy solutions exemplifies how technology can drive sustainability. By creating a closed-loop system, Tesla minimizes its environmental footprint while promoting clean energy adoption.

Common Obstacles in Environmental Sustainability Innovation Programs
Despite their potential, these programs face several challenges:
- High Initial Costs: Investments in new technologies and infrastructure can be prohibitive for some organizations.
- Resistance to Change: Employees and stakeholders may be reluctant to adopt new practices.
- Data Gaps: Lack of accurate data can hinder the measurement and management of sustainability efforts.
- Regulatory Complexity: Navigating varying environmental regulations across regions can be challenging.
- Short-Term Focus: Businesses often prioritize immediate financial returns over long-term sustainability goals.
Solutions to Overcome Environmental Sustainability Innovation Program Challenges
- Financial Incentives: Leverage government grants, subsidies, and tax breaks to offset initial costs.
- Change Management: Implement training programs and communication strategies to foster a culture of sustainability.
- Data Analytics: Invest in tools and technologies that provide real-time insights into environmental performance.
- Policy Advocacy: Engage with policymakers to streamline regulations and promote sustainability-friendly policies.
- Long-Term Planning: Develop a clear roadmap with measurable milestones to align short-term actions with long-term goals.

Innovative Tools for Environmental Sustainability Innovation Programs
- Life Cycle Assessment (LCA) Software: Tools like SimaPro and GaBi help organizations evaluate the environmental impact of their products and processes.
- Energy Management Systems (EMS): Platforms like Schneider Electric's EcoStruxure enable real-time monitoring and optimization of energy use.
- Waste Tracking Solutions: Technologies like Rubicon's smart waste management system help businesses reduce landfill contributions.

Metrics for Evaluating Environmental Sustainability Innovation Programs
- Carbon Footprint: Total greenhouse gas emissions produced by an organization or product.
- Energy Efficiency: Ratio of energy output to energy input in operations.
- Water Usage: Volume of water consumed and recycled.
- Waste Diversion Rate: Percentage of waste diverted from landfills through recycling or composting.
- Biodiversity Impact: Assessment of an organization's effect on local ecosystems.

Step-by-step guide to implementing environmental sustainability innovation programs
- Assess Current Impact: Conduct a baseline assessment of your organization's environmental footprint.
- Set Clear Goals: Define specific, measurable, achievable, relevant, and time-bound (SMART) sustainability objectives.
- Engage Stakeholders: Involve employees, customers, and partners in the planning process.
- Develop a Strategy: Create a detailed roadmap outlining actions, timelines, and responsibilities.
- Leverage Technology: Invest in tools and platforms that support sustainability initiatives.
- Monitor Progress: Use key performance indicators (KPIs) to track and report on progress.
- Iterate and Improve: Continuously refine your approach based on feedback and new insights.
